Environment and Ambiance

The most striking aspect of The Newport Harbor Hotel and Marina is its unparalleled waterfront setting. The hotel offers picturesque views of the harbor, marina, and the surrounding historic downtown, especially from rooms with a harbor view or the outdoor sundeck. The property features its own 60-slip marina, making it a preferred spot for boating enthusiasts and adding to the overall nautical ambiance. Guests can enjoy a sprawling 3,000 square foot lawn overlooking the marina, complete with a fire pit, hammocks, and areas for lawn games, providing a relaxing outdoor space.

Indoors, the hotel features an indoor heated saltwater pool, offering year-round recreation, and a fitness center. There's also an on-site restaurant, SALTwater, which specializes in seafood and offers dining with harbor views. A coffee shop/cafe and a bar/lounge are also available. Services and Amenities

The Newport Harbor Hotel and Marina aims to provide a comprehensive range of services to enhance guest stays. The front desk operates 24 hours a day, with staff generally described as helpful and capable of recommending local attractions. However, some guests have reported mixed experiences with check-in and check-out efficiency, indicating variability in service at times.

Key amenities include an indoor heated saltwater pool, open daily from 9 AM to 9 PM, providing a relaxing option regardless of the weather. A fitness center is also available 24 hours a day. The hotel offers a restaurant, SALTwater, for dining, and a coffee shop/cafe. While breakfast is available, it is a "to-go breakfast" and comes with a surcharge (approximately USD 8-20 per person).

Complimentary high-speed WiFi (250+ Mbps) is provided in all rooms and public areas. Self-parking is available on-site, but it's important to note that a fee of USD 35 per day applies, which includes in/out privileges. This parking fee, along with a daily resort fee of USD 35.00 per accommodation per night, has been a point of contention for some guests who feel the additional costs are not always transparent or commensurate with the value received. The resort fee reportedly includes various amenities like bicycle rentals, business center access, in-room bottled water and coffee, and laundry facilities.

Other services include express check-out, luggage storage, concierge services, dry cleaning/laundry service, and multilingual staff. For events, the hotel offers wedding services and boasts extensive meeting and event space, including a banquet hall and outdoor areas. Free bicycle rentals are available seasonally on a first-come, first-served basis, as are complimentary inflatable paddleboards and kayaks at the marina, adding to recreational opportunities.

Features of the Rooms

The Newport Harbor Hotel and Marina features 133 guest rooms. Rooms are designed with a nautical inspiration and offer either city views (overlooking historic downtown) or harbor views. While some older reviews mentioned dated furnishings or cleanliness issues in bathrooms, more recent information emphasizes that rooms are "beautifully appointed," with "modern amenities, elegant furnishings, and soothing color palettes." Many rooms feature pillowtop mattresses and hypo-allergenic bedding for comfort. Guests have generally found the beds to be comfortable.

Standard in-room amenities include air conditioning (climate-controlled), a 32-inch HDTV with premium channels, a mini-fridge, and a coffee/tea maker. Private bathrooms come with a shower/tub combination, hairdryer, and complimentary toiletries. Rooms also offer a desk, laptop-friendly workspace, an iron and ironing board, and blackout drapes/curtains. Free bottled water is provided in the room as part of the resort fee. Free cribs/infant beds are available upon request, and connecting rooms can be arranged, catering to families. Noise can be a factor due to thin walls and being on the water, as noted in some guest experiences.

Should’ve Trusted Our Gut the First Time We stayed at Newport Harbor Hotel & Marina once before, just after COVID. Back then, it was outdated, the staff was “meh,” and we chalked it up to the post-pandemic slump. We didn’t leave a review because we figured we’d give them grace. Big mistake. Fast forward to our 4-year anniversary trip, and we remembered exactly why we never came back. We checked in on Thursday. There was a mountain of garbage in the first stairwell — bags on bags, stinking up the place. Guess what? It was still there on Saturday. I’ve got pictures to prove it. Now let’s talk about the hidden fees — and there are plenty. You’ll pay $35/day to park in their own lot. Want to use the pool or reheat food in the one community microwave they leave in the lobby? That’s another $35/day. They’ll toss a fridge in your room, but apparently, warming up leftovers is a luxury. Oh, and just to cap things off, we found a tick crawling around our bathroom. Again — got the photo. Between the base rate and all the hidden charges, we spent $850 for three nights. For that price, we expected at least basic cleanliness and transparency. What we got was an overpriced motel with a harbor view. Save your money and go literally anywhere else.
